Dominic Franks lives in Bellow in Lincolnshire. He runs an events company called the Persuaders which puts on launches, fashion shows, and brings brands to life working on their identity. On the plinth he is going to take photographs from the plinth and plans to take one per minute, though he may end up taking more. He will then put them on his website so other people can see what he saw from the plinth. He likes the statement art creating art.
